Lincoln Appoints Sarah Rae As Director For Middle East

Lincoln has appointed Sarah Rae to the position of Director, Lincoln Middle East, replacing Alex Schaeffer, who repatriated to Dearborn, Michigan, to take up a new position in Ford Motor Company. She will report to Metelo Arias, Vice President, Marketing, Sales and Services, Ford Middle East and Africa.

In her new role, Ms Rae will lead Lincoln’s operations in the Middle East as the luxury automotive brand continues to expand its business in the region.

Prior to this role, Ms Rae served as Lincoln Middle East’s brand manager, and has played an integral part in the recent launch of the all new Navigator full size SUV and the brand’s dealership development in the UAE. She joined Ford Motor Company in 1995 and brings more than 20 years of automotive industry experience as a marketing and sales professional.

Lincoln is witnessing enhancements to its representation in the Middle East. Earlier this year Lincoln welcomed Alghanim Auto as its official distributor in Kuwait, delivering its luxury automotive experience to customers in the region, while the highly anticipated Al Tayer Motors stand-alone Lincoln 3S facility in Dubai is expected to open its doors before the end of this year.
